Quarterbridge deliver innovative solutions based on practical experience from the UK and abroad. Our client list includes councils, development companies, market operators and branches of the National Market Traders’ Federation. Quarterbridge are approved consultants to the National Market Traders Federation and members of the Association of Town & City Management and Institute of Place Management

. All work undertaken by Quarterbridge is backed by a full professional indemnity insurance underwritten at Lloyds of London.

More than £17 million has been awarded to North East Lincolnshire to deliver changes to Grimsby town centre, including a fresh home for Grimsby’s Top Town Market and the redevelopment of part of Freshney Place Shopping Centre, to incorporate a new cinema and leisure facilities nearby.

We want to hear from you about how you use the market currently, what you would like to see in the future and your opinions on independent retail, food and drink and leisure options to support the existing traders and create a vibrant, modern market offer.

Chesterfield Borough Council has successfully secured £1.15m of funding for the Market Square to deliver a vibrant and modern shopping experience that supports the traders and attracts new traders and customers.

Concept designs have been produced following consultation with the public, market traders and local businesses to create an exciting space that can support the market, regular events and activity and create an inviting social space.

We are now consulting on the plans to understand your opinions on the scheme, building on the first public engagement exercise to look for specific feedback on these proposals.

Market and independent retail specialists, Quarterbridge, are working with Wycombe District Council to undertake a review of High Wycombe Market and understand how the market, new occasional markets, and events, combined with regeneration plans aimed at creating space for new independent businesses, can provide footfall, visitor attraction and appeal to people that live and work in the town – and for visitors from the wider area.

We are undertaking public consultation to understand your opinions on the Street Market and how you use the town centre. We want to understand your thoughts on the future of the market and future events, and how they could be used to attract more visitors to the town centre.
